2019: Engaging and Collaborating

I introduced APAC Connect when I joined in October 2018, and at our first regional session we decided to bring all our firms together to form an Allinial Global APAC family bond. As firm partners got to know each other, we introduced several collaborative commerce projects at the regional conference in April. Highlights for the year included:

  • APAC Connect. APAC Connect enables sharing and keeps firm leaders updated on notable happenings each quarter.
  • APAC Communities. We launched four communities (Audit & Assurance, Tax, Corporate Finance, and Accounting Outsourcing), bringing the sub-families of regional firms together.
  • APAC Collaboration Projects. Firms elected to work together to create commerce by sharing existing clients.
  • APAC Wish List. This annual list highlights what firms hope to achieve in the upcoming year.

2020: Innovate, Integrate, and Motivate

In 2020 we organized various initiatives around shared values, purposes, and practices, leaving the details of particular beliefs to the creativity of the communities themselves. It was an exciting and dynamic year for us despite the pandemic causing an initial downturn effect for some firms. Together, we leapfrogged to support each other’s endeavours, enabling many to realize the benefits the following year.  Highlights for 2020 included:

  • APAC References. We created a regional “At a Glance” meeting calendar, a regional handbook (summary), and an inaugural newsletter.
  • New APAC Communities. 2020 saw the addition of new communities for Business Development, the Firm of the Future, and Human Resources, as well as an APAC Webinar Series that is complimentary and open to all member firm staff.
  • Strategic Meetings. Strategic meetings included Global Working Group facilitation focused on managing through COVID together, a CEO townhall session, and year-end reflection on our wish list realization.

2021: Re-Imagine, Re-Position, and Re-Create for Transformation

The coronavirus continued to turn lives upside down with quarantines and cancelled plans, lockdowns and isolations, fear and uncertainty, and most significantly, anxiety and stress. However, Allinial Global APAC member firms grew stronger together, doubling down on strategic initiatives, which included:

  • APAC LinkedIn. We launched an APAC-specific LinkedIn page to highlight regional news and events.
  • APAC Connect Transformation with Value-Add Quick Bites. This included special invites (e.g., introduction of new AG member firms from other regions), as well as strategic roundtable discussions and sharing.
  • Purpose-Built APAC Community Projects. We implemented projects to make community journeys more meaningful and impactful, including a Capabilities Matrix, Standardized Firm Profiles, an Audit Process Flow Chart, Member-to-Member Missions, etc.
  • APAC-Specific Training Series. This series saw an influx of audience participation compared to the AG Webinar Series, sometimes with over 100 participants.
  • Doing Business in Asia Pacific (DBI APAC) Roadshows. We not only increased total participation but also shifted the ratio of consultants to prospective clients within the audience. With more prospects than consultants in attendance now, we are thrilled to reach more potential clients through this series.
